How much does a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V make in Idaho? The average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V salary in Idaho is $142,200 as of May 28, 2024, but the range typically falls between $128,900 and $156,000.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Job Description

The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V uses machine learning, computational methods, and data analysis to identify, implement, and test relevant and viable algorithms for modeling a system or problem. Designs, develops, and evaluates the effectiveness of algorithms and frameworks to simulate and model complex systems such as behavior, threat detection, or real-world systems or vision. Being a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V develops visualizations to review and communicate results. Creates scalable frameworks to run simulations repeatedly and quickly or model operational environments and processes. In addition,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V writes and reviews code in relevant languages, packages, and libraries. Typically requires a master's degree in mathematics, physics, computer science, or engineering.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Being a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V work is highly independent. May assume a team lead role for the work group. A specialist on complex technical and business matters. Working as a Modeling & Simulation Engineer IV typically requires 7+ years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
